try this:
ive just replaced my barely functioning lcd by myself, after living with it sometimes registered the stylus jumping around when i used the stylus. but before you change your lcd, here is a couple of tips for you guys:
1) try sliding out the keyboard. hold one finger in the middle of the keyboard and another on the back side of the phone, and squeeze hard, but careful. it might be that the flat cable between the screen part and the main part has loosened a bit from its socket, this could help it back in.
2) try sqeezing the hang up button hard. this might help the lcd-cable correctly back in its socket if it is loose.
im saying that this MIGHT help, if youre lucky. most likely you have to open the phone and squeeze the connectors back in yourself, or actually change the entire lcd. anyways, let me know what works for you!!

Not A Software Problem...
The issue you are having is indeed a hardware problem. Well for the OP it is. I had a Nexus that was in the same situation. You can tell its not a hardware problem because if you remove the battery and put battery back in, the phone wont power up unless you press the power button like 8 to 10 times. That my friend is a hardware situation.
I created a small fix for mine. I should have created a youtube video of it lol. What I did was removed the back cover and batter and inbetween the Power Button and The Phone itself youll see like a small crack or very small gap of space between the phone and button. I stuck some small very small thin piece of paper in that gap. This will raise the buttun away from the phone just a lil bit. Put the battery back in and back cover back on. And noticed my button working 100% again.
So long story short the button itself starts to not make contact with the switch on the mother board or somethin. My bootloader was unlocked so i never got HTC involved. If your on cyan lates rom you can set it to wake via trackball under settings.
